Output ef6d41ba3a500c5a4c9b20a7b15ffaded85f9cf1852c105ad143c18cfaeb2b1e:14

value
551448590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d46876fd62094e1e333dc3f9e5e61f1e9b3adb6 OP_EQUAL
address
MAZxKSLJyVSNigDDZLipc17snvXe6dzEA2
transaction
ef6d41ba3a500c5a4c9b20a7b15ffaded85f9cf1852c105ad143c18cfaeb2b1e
spent
true